If you owe past income taxes or money to the UIA, the Michigan Department of the Treasury can take all or part of your federal and/or state income tax refund to pay the debt. If you become unemployed and get unemployment benefits while you still owe an overpayment, 50 percent (or 100 percent if fraud was involved in the original overpayment) of your weekly unemployment benefit payment will be taken for repayment. The pause does not stop collections activities such as existing wage garnishments, intercepting federal tax returns, deducting a percentage from current unemployment benefit payments, or recovering overpayments for other states. In late December 2022, Michigan's Unemployment Insurance Agency (UIA) said it would temporarily stop trying to collect overpayments from people who filed for unemployment insurance since March 1, 2020. This means the UIA should stop sending collection letters or doing anything else to make people pay these overpayments. How Do I Join a Class Action and How Does it Work for Me? When those claimants appealed the decision and the case went before a judge, agency representatives said theclaimantswere liable because they hadentered their gross pay from prior years to determine their weekly benefit amountwhen they should have entered their net pay.
